| Lemon tree | First useful lemons | Stronger crop | Timing note |
|---|---|---|---|
| Grafted Meyer lemon | 1 to 3 years old | 3 to 5 years old | Can flower in several waves when warm and well fed. |
| Grafted Eureka or Lisbon | 2 to 4 years old | 4 to 6 years old | Needs healthy leaf area before carrying many lemons. |
| Dwarf container lemon | 2 to 5 years old | 4 to 7 years old | Root volume, watering swings, and feeding decide the pace. |
| Seed-grown lemon | 5 to 10 years old | 8 to 12 years old | Juvenile wood delays bloom even if the tree looks large. |
| Variety | Common bloom habit | Main harvest feel | Calculator adjustment |
|---|---|---|---|
| Improved Meyer | Spring plus repeat flushes | Fall through winter, often extended | Earlier baseline, lower delay when protected. |
| Eureka | Frequent bloom in mild zones | Nearly year-round in warm climates | Medium baseline with strong sun reward. |
| Lisbon | Heavy spring bloom | Winter through spring | Slightly later, better heat and wind tolerance. |
| Ponderosa | Ornamental repeat bloom | Large fruit, slower ripening | Moderate delay for oversize fruit load. |
| Factor | Best range | Delay signal | Why it matters |
|---|---|---|---|
| Direct sun | 8 or more hours | Under 6 hours | Flowering wood needs stored carbohydrates from healthy leaves. |
| Water | Even moisture, good drainage | Wilt, leaf drop, sour soil | Stress can drop blossoms and small fruit. |
| Nutrition | Citrus fertilizer during growth | Pale leaves, weak flush | Nitrogen and micronutrients support bloom and fruit fill. |
| Canopy size | Balanced leaf area | Hard pruning or defoliation | Small trees often abort fruit to keep growing. |

This calculator gives planning estimates for home citrus care. Local cultivar behavior, rootstock, disease pressure, and nursery age can move real fruiting earlier or later.
A few flowers do not always mean a harvest. Young lemon trees often drop fruit until roots and leaves can support it.
Small pots may bloom early but crop lightly. Step up gradually and avoid wet, stale potting mix.
After a hard freeze, count timing from the recovered canopy rather than the original planting date.
A seed-grown lemon can be healthy and still take many years to flower because the wood is juvenile.
